Why you should think twice before using Stake during the World Cup.
This is based on my personal experience with @Stake and @StakeEddie as a profitable sports bettor.
The moment you consistently win, they start heavily limiting your account to the point where placing serious bets becomes impossible.
But here’s the part I find extremely misleading:
They don’t clearly show those betting limits before you deposit.
You deposit funds expecting to place sports bets, then suddenly discover your account is restricted to tiny wager sizes. After that, when you try to withdraw your balance, they require you to wager the deposited amount first through their casino products.
So if I deposit $5,000 for sports betting and later realize my account is heavily limited, I’m suddenly expected to play slots or casino games just to unlock my own deposit.
That behavior is incredibly shady in my opinion, especially before one of the biggest betting events in the world.
There are plenty of other casinos and sportsbooks out there. If you’re a serious bettor, be careful where you deposit during the World Cup.
I attached screenshots of the limits they placed on my account. It’s honestly ridiculous.
